First-day checklist — item 4: Intern cohort arrival

Heads up, contractors on the Brayfield site: Monday is also the day the summer intern cohort lands, so the lobby will be busier than usual. Please arrive before 9 so the sign-in kiosk isn't swamped, and don't be surprised by the welcome banners everywhere. The interns get escorted in groups, but you don't need to wait with them — head straight for the east turnstiles. To get through before your permanent pass is issued, use the day code below.

staff pass of kagup-fajog = bdg-QCHVQW-99665837

## Shelfstream Catalogue Import — Environments

Shelfstream runs three environments: sandbox, staging, and production. Plugin authors should develop against sandbox, where catalogue imports run hourly from a fixture dataset and record limits are relaxed. Staging mirrors production schemas and enforces full MARC validation, so test your field mappers there before release. Production imports are scheduled nightly and locked to approved plugins only. Each environment ships with its own import settings, reproduced below.

settings of bafof-fajog:
[aldix]
port = 9300
region = north-3
host = aldix.kelvilabs.example
team = istath
timeout_ms = 1500
retries = 8

Hey Priya — handing off the Larkspur template rendering work before I'm out. Short version: the partial cache was thrashing because we keyed on full request paths, so I switched it to template-name keys and render times dropped ~40%. Watch p95 on the storefront pages after Thursday's release; if it creeps past 200ms, the precompile flag probably didn't take. Marco from the Veldt team has context if I'm unreachable. The current settings for staging are below.

settings of yageg-yahap:
[gorael]
team = olieth
access_code = ac_941d74
owner = brieth.aldiel
host = gorael.tolvaqio.internal
port = 6379
peer = briwyn.urlaqtech.internal
salt = 116e6622
pin = 1957

Support team onboarding note: cold storage buckets in the Driftvault archive tier are sealed quarterly by the Harbormist platform crew. Once sealed, a bucket cannot be reopened through the normal console — restore requests route through the archive custodian workflow instead. If a customer escalation requires an emergency unseal, file the request and, when approved, unlock the archive index with the passphrase given directly below.

recovery phrase for tagug-yagug: lamox-gilax-keleth-gilath